package testing
import (
"testing"
EQ "github.com/IBM/fp-go/eq"
L "github.com/IBM/fp-go/internal/monad/testing"
P "github.com/IBM/fp-go/pair"
M "github.com/IBM/fp-go/monoid"
)
// AssertLaws asserts the apply monad laws for the [P.Pair] monad
func assertLawsHead[E, A, B, C any](t *testing.T,
m M.Monoid[E],
eqe EQ.Eq[E],
eqa EQ.Eq[A],
eqb EQ.Eq[B],
eqc EQ.Eq[C],
ab func(A) B,
bc func(B) C,
) func(a A) bool {
fofc := P.Pointed[C](m)
fofaa := P.Pointed[func(A) A](m)
fofbc := P.Pointed[func(B) C](m)
fofabb := P.Pointed[func(func(A) B) B](m)
fmap := P.Functor[func(B) C, E, func(func(A) B) func(A) C]()
fapabb := P.Applicative[func(A) B, E, B](m)
fapabac := P.Applicative[func(A) B, E, func(A) C](m)
maa := P.Monad[A, E, A](m)
mab := P.Monad[A, E, B](m)
mac := P.Monad[A, E, C](m)
mbc := P.Monad[B, E, C](m)
return L.MonadAssertLaws(t,
P.Eq(eqa, eqe),
P.Eq(eqb, eqe),
P.Eq(eqc, eqe),
fofc,
fofaa,
fofbc,
fofabb,
fmap,
fapabb,
fapabac,
maa,
mab,
mac,
mbc,
ab,
bc,
)
}
// AssertLaws asserts the apply monad laws for the [P.Pair] monad
func assertLawsTail[E, A, B, C any](t *testing.T,
m M.Monoid[E],
eqe EQ.Eq[E],
eqa EQ.Eq[A],
eqb EQ.Eq[B],
eqc EQ.Eq[C],
ab func(A) B,
bc func(B) C,
) func(a A) bool {
fofc := P.PointedTail[C](m)
fofaa := P.PointedTail[func(A) A](m)
fofbc := P.PointedTail[func(B) C](m)
fofabb := P.PointedTail[func(func(A) B) B](m)
fmap := P.FunctorTail[func(B) C, E, func(func(A) B) func(A) C]()
fapabb := P.ApplicativeTail[func(A) B, E, B](m)
fapabac := P.ApplicativeTail[func(A) B, E, func(A) C](m)
maa := P.MonadTail[A, E, A](m)
mab := P.MonadTail[A, E, B](m)
mac := P.MonadTail[A, E, C](m)
mbc := P.MonadTail[B, E, C](m)
return L.MonadAssertLaws(t,
P.Eq(eqe, eqa),
P.Eq(eqe, eqb),
P.Eq(eqe, eqc),
fofc,
fofaa,
fofbc,
fofabb,
fmap,
fapabb,
fapabac,
maa,
mab,
mac,
mbc,
ab,
bc,
)
}
// AssertLaws asserts the apply monad laws for the [P.Pair] monad
func AssertLaws[E, A, B, C any](t *testing.T,
m M.Monoid[E],
eqe EQ.Eq[E],
eqa EQ.Eq[A],
eqb EQ.Eq[B],
eqc EQ.Eq[C],
ab func(A) B,
bc func(B) C,
) func(A) bool {
head := assertLawsHead(t, m, eqe, eqa, eqb, eqc, ab, bc)
tail := assertLawsHead(t, m, eqe, eqa, eqb, eqc, ab, bc)
return func(a A) bool {
return head(a) && tail(a)
}
}
